The Fondsimmobilier de solidarité FTQ has partnered with Cogir Real Estate to construct the new UniCité rental residential project in Canada.

To be constructed on Molson Street in Rosemont–La Petite-Patrie, Montréal, the new building will accommodate 175 units and 32,292ft² of commercial space on the ground floor, which would be occupied by an IGA supermarket.

The structure will also feature 28 community housing units managed by a housing cooperative with the help of social economy enterprise Bâtir son quartier.

Fondsimmobilier de solidarité FTQ president and CEO Normand Bélanger said: “UniCité is a comprehensive project that will create some 400 jobs. With access to Pélicanpark, bicycle paths and public transit, it’s a great housing option for both young families and retirees.”

The 67,725ft² building will include seven aboveground floors and an outdoor pool on top of the commercial space.

Other amenities will include a fitness room on the first floor, 5,080ft² of additional commercial space for convenience stores, bicycle racks, and two-storey underground space to park 148 cars.
